Output 59f4b4f9b4e369f310cf95cc4e25d2eb60ce6d4b8549c48ead76ff46766eec08:0

value
11709102
script pubkey
OP_0 OP_PUSHBYTES_20 dd626e19ad166d885bc6f0d98aa5f174e91631e1
address
bc1qm43xuxddzekcsk7x7rvc4f03wn53vv0pg0qj33
transaction
59f4b4f9b4e369f310cf95cc4e25d2eb60ce6d4b8549c48ead76ff46766eec08
spent
true